Top Investment Strategies For Axis Mutual Funds’ Small-Cap Funds

Investing in the stock market can be pretty volatile, particularly with AXIS MF.

These funds invest in businesses with tiny market capitalizations, which may present more significant growth opportunities and risks. Nonetheless, you can successfully navigate the small-cap market and earn sizable returns using the appropriate investing techniques. Here, we look at five excellent small-cap fund investing strategies to help you decide wisely and maximize your investments.

Puntos clave

  • Axis Small Cap Fund has delivered strong returns, outperforming its benchmark index Nifty Smallcap 250 over 3-year and 5-year periods.
  • The fund follows a bottom-up stock selection approach, focusing on companies with robust business models and sustainable competitive advantages.
  • It maintains a diversified portfolio of 70-80 stocks to manage risk, with the fund manager actively adjusting cash levels based on market conditions.
  • While small cap funds can be volatile, Axis Small Cap Fund’s consistent performance and experienced fund management team make it a compelling choice for long-term investors.
  • Investors should assess their risk tolerance and investment horizon before investing, as small cap funds are suitable for those with a high risk appetite and a long-term investment outlook of at least 5-7 years.

1. It’s important to diversify!

When it comes to small-cap funds, it’s important to follow the golden rule of investment. Diversification is key to minimizing risk and avoiding overexposure to the volatility of a single stock or industry. Small-cap funds can be diversified across different markets, sectors, or investment strategies, which can help mitigate the impacto on your overall portfolio if one fund performs poorly compared to the others.

3. Carry Out Extensive Study

Small-cap firms regularly receive less regular attention from the media and more from analysts than their larger counterparts. As a result, it is essential to conduct thorough research to identify promising small-cap funds and the businesses they invest in. Look for funds with managers with a long history of solid performance in the small-cap market and investment expertise in analyzing and choosing. You must also be able to tailor the fund to your investing goals and your comfort level with risk.

4. Take into account a SIP (Systematic Investment Plan)

Save for the core, using a Systematic Investment Plan to invest in small-cap funds can also be applied and is a strategy that can be used to reduce the market’s volatility. This might be the opportunity to implement rupee-cost averaging, which occurs when an investor decides to invest a specific amount each month or quarter. It’ll assist in lowering the total cost of investing since you will acquire additional units when the price is low and fewer units when the price is high.
